Lymphocyte subpopulations in peripheral blood were studied in 30 patients with IgA-glomerulonephritis and 24 healthy subjects via application of specific monoclonal antibodies. The following deviations were established: reduced number of OKT11 + cells (37.83 +/- 13.34, p less than 0.01): increased number of OKT8 + cells (25.89 +/- 6.70, p less than 0.01), no change in the number of OKM4 + cells, increased number of peripheral monocytes--OKM1 + cells (19.26 +/- 6.63, p less than 0.001). No significant correlations were established between the deviated parameters and arterial pressure, serum creatinine and serum IgA levels.
